Shares of Indian solar companies, including Waaree Energies and Premier Energies, fell by 10% after the US imposed tariffs on imports from India. The US Commerce Department announced preliminary countervailing duties of approximately 126% on solar cell and panel imports, citing unfair government subsidies. Other companies like Vikram Solar and Waaree Renewable Technologies also experienced declines. This decision is part of a trade case initiated by the Alliance for American Solar Manufacturing, with a further ruling expected next month regarding pricing practices.
